Subject: RE: [xsl] conditional based html formated output - reg From: "Robby Pelssers" <robby.pelssers@xxxxxxxxx> Date: Fri, 2 Apr 2010 14:46:56 +0200 |
I wonder what the output of the named template data is... is that also inserting <td>'s ?? Can you post this as well? I think you are making a logical error in the processing but without seeing what <xsl:template name="data"> does I can't really help. Robby -----Original Message----- From: Ramesh Kumar [mailto:cnrameshkumar@xxxxxxxxx] Sent: Friday, April 02, 2010 12:31 PM To: xsl-list@xxxxxxxxxxxxxxxxxxxxxx Subject: [xsl] conditional based html formated output - reg Dear All, Can anyone help me to clear the error in the below xsl template. I am trying to create a table. The cells are created based on key value. So i need to start a row <TR> based on a condition. Also the end tag </TR> for that row will be based on another condition. But without end tag </TR> the <xsl:if> element is giving error. <xsl:template name="FrameMatrix"> <xsl:param name="rowkey"/> <xsl:param name="seqkey"/> <xsl:param name="colkey"/> <xsl:if test="not(contains($RowKeyList, concat(',', rowkey)))"> <tr> <td> <xsl:value-of select="RowKey"/> </td> <td> <xsl:value-of select="CategoryName"/> </td> </xsl:if> <xsl:for-each select="key('col-name', concat($colkey, $rowkey, $seqkey))"> <xsl:call-template name="data" /> </xsl:for-each> <xsl:if test="not(contains($RowKeyList, concat(rowkey, ',')))"> </tr> </xsl:if> </xsl:template> -- Regards, Ramesh
Current Thread |
---|
|
<- Previous | Index | Next -> |
---|---|---|
[xsl] conditional based html format, Ramesh Kumar | Thread | Re: [xsl] conditional based html fo, David Carlisle |
Re: [xsl] grouping problem, Martin Honnen | Date | Re: [xsl] conditional based html fo, David Carlisle |
Month |